Summary of Cleansing Methods



When picking a cleaning approach, comprehending the distinctions between stress cleaning and typical cleaning techniques is crucial.

Pressure washing uses high-pressure water jets to get rid of dirt, crud, and discolorations from surface areas like driveways, decks, and house siding. This method is effective, specifically for hard, persistent stains that might withstand standard cleaning.

On the other hand, standard cleaning usually entails scrubbing surface areas with brushes, mops, or towels, frequently integrated with cleaning agents or soaps. It's a much more hands-on approach, counting on physical effort and time to achieve tidiness.

Standard methods can be efficient, yet they might not resolve deeply deep-rooted dust or large locations as swiftly as stress cleaning can.

Additionally, you require to think about the surfaces you're cleansing. While stress cleaning is excellent for sturdy surface areas, it might damage softer materials or sensitive locations otherwise done thoroughly.

Standard cleaning approaches often tend to be safer for various surfaces but may call for more initiative and time.

Ultimately, your choice depends on the cleaning job at hand, the kind of surface, and your wanted result. By comprehending these techniques, you can make an educated choice that satisfies your cleansing requires.

Benefits of Stress Laundering



Pressure cleaning deals a number of benefits that make it a recommended option for numerous cleaning jobs. Primarily, it saves you time. With high-pressure water streams, you can clean up huge locations in a portion of the time it would take with standard techniques. This efficiency permits you to tackle tasks like driveways, decks, and home siding quickly.



You'll likewise discover that stress cleaning is highly efficient in removing stubborn dirt, crud, mold, and mildew. The force of the water permeates surface areas, lifting away impurities that might be difficult to eliminate with a brush or towel. This not just enhances the appearance of your residential or commercial property however additionally aids maintain its value over time.

An additional significant benefit is the eco-friendliness of stress cleaning. It typically calls for less chemicals than traditional cleansing approaches, relying primarily on water to do the job. Last but not least, stress washing enhances security by eliminating unsafe mold and algae on surface areas. By maintaining your sidewalks and driveways tidy, you're minimizing the risk of accidents, making your home a much safer place for you and your visitors.

Advantages of Traditional Cleaning



Traditional cleaning approaches have their very own collection of advantages that make them appealing for certain jobs. You can customize the technique and products to fit the particular surface or product, ensuring you don't damage anything fragile. This is particularly important when dealing with antiques or sensitive fabrics.

Furthermore, traditional cleansing frequently utilizes much less water than stress cleaning, making it a much more environmentally friendly choice. You're additionally less most likely to disturb bordering areas or develop runoff that can influence your landscape design.

Price is an additional variable to consider. Traditional cleansing techniques typically call for less upfront investments in tools contrasted to press washing equipments, which can be costly. Plus, you can commonly locate cleansing products at any neighborhood shop, making them easily accessible and convenient.

Finally, the hands-on method of typical cleansing permits you to link more with your room. You can take note of detail and notice locations that may need additional care. In most cases, this thoroughness results in a much deeper tidy, ensuring you maintain your home or work space efficiently.
